Service
1. Use extreme care in handlinggasoline and other fuels.
They are extremely flammable and the vapors are
explosive.
2. Store fuel and oil in approved containers, away from heat
and open flame, and out ofthe reach of children.
3. Check and add fuel before starting the engine. Never
remove gas cap or add fuel while the engine is running.
Allow engine to cool at least two minutes before refueling.
4. Replace gasoline cap securely and wipe off any spilled
gasoline before starting the engine as it may cause a fire
or explosion.
5. Extinguish all cigarettes, cigars, pipes and other sources
of ignition.
6. Never refuel unit indoors because flammable vapors will
accumulate in the area.
7. Never store the machine or fuel container inside where
there is an open flame or spark such as a gas hot water
heater, clothes dryer or furnace.
8. Never run your machine in an enclosed area as the
exhaust from the engine contains carbon monoxide,
which is an odorless, tasteless and deadly poisonous
gas.
9. To reduce fire hazard, keep engine and muffler free of
leaves, grass, and other debris build-up.
10. Clean up fuel and oil spillage. Allow unit to cool at least 5
minutes before storing.
11. Before cleaning, repairing, or inspecting, make certain
the impeller and all moving parts have stopped.
Disconnect the spark plug wire and keep wire away from
spark plug to prevent accidental starting. Do not use
flammable solutions to clean air filter.
12. Keep all nuts, bolts, and screws tight to be sure the
equipment is in safe working condition.
13. Never tamper with safety devices. Check their proper
operation regularly.
14. Do not alter or tamper with the engine's governor setting.
The governor controls the maximum safe operating
speed of the engine. Overspeeding the engine is
dangerous and will cause damage to the engine and to
other moving parts of the machine.
